A circular well of radius 3.5 m is dug 20 m deep and the earth so dug is spread on a rectangular plot of length 14 m and breadth 11 m. Find :
Volume of the earth dug-out.

The correct Answer is:
To solve the problem, we need to find the volume of the earth dug out from the circular well and then confirm that this volume can be spread over the rectangular plot.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Identify the dimensions of the well:** - Radius (r) = 3.5 m - Depth (h) = 20 m 2. **Calculate the volume of the circular well:** The volume \( V \) of a cylinder (which is the shape of the well) is given by the formula: \[ V = \pi r^2 h \] Here, we will use \( \pi \approx \frac{22}{7} \). 3. **Substituting the values into the formula:** \[ V = \frac{22}{7} \times (3.5)^2 \times 20 \] 4. **Calculate \( (3.5)^2 \):** \[ (3.5)^2 = 12.25 \] 5. **Now substitute \( (3.5)^2 \) back into the volume formula:** \[ V = \frac{22}{7} \times 12.25 \times 20 \] 6. **Multiply \( 12.25 \) by \( 20 \):** \[ 12.25 \times 20 = 245 \] 7. **Now calculate the volume:** \[ V = \frac{22}{7} \times 245 \] 8. **Calculate \( \frac{22 \times 245}{7} \):** - First, calculate \( 22 \times 245 = 5390 \). - Now divide by \( 7 \): \[ V = \frac{5390}{7} = 770 \text{ m}^3 \] 9. **The volume of earth dug out is 770 m³.** 10. **Now, we need to find the height of the soil when spread over the rectangular plot:** - Length of the plot (L) = 14 m - Breadth of the plot (B) = 11 m 11. **Calculate the area of the rectangular plot:** \[ \text{Area} = L \times B = 14 \times 11 = 154 \text{ m}^2 \] 12. **Let the height of the soil spread be \( h \). The volume of the soil spread is given by:** \[ \text{Volume} = \text{Area} \times \text{Height} = 154 \times h \] 13. **Setting the volume of the soil equal to the volume of the well:** \[ 154h = 770 \] 14. **Now solve for \( h \):** \[ h = \frac{770}{154} = 5 \text{ m} \] ### Final Answer: The height of the soil when spread over the rectangular plot is **5 meters**.
